C

Charles Walker
Review of Cyber 3d

1 year ago

👍 Cyber 3d is an amazing company! Their work is si...

👍 Cyber 3d is an amazing company! Their work is simply exceptional. I was really impressed with their attention to detail and the creativity they brought to the table. Their team is incredibly talented and they have a knack for delivering exceptional results.

Comments:

No comments